@implementation OFDNSResolverQuery
@synthesize host = _host, recordClass = _recordClass, recordType = _recordType;
@synthesize ID = _ID, nameServers = _nameServers;
@synthesize searchDomains = _searchDomains;
@synthesize nameServersIndex = _nameServersIndex;
@synthesize searchDomainsIndex = _searchDomainsIndex, target = _target;
@synthesize selector = _selector, context = _context, queryData = _queryData;
@synthesize cancelTimer = _cancelTimer;

- (instancetype)initWithHost: (OFString *)host
		 recordClass: (of_dns_resource_record_class_t)recordClass
		  recordType: (of_dns_resource_record_type_t)recordType
			  ID: (OFNumber *)ID
		 nameServers: (OFArray OF_GENERIC(OFString *) *)nameServers
	       searchDomains: (OFArray OF_GENERIC(OFString *) *)searchDomains

		      target: (id)target
		    selector: (SEL)selector
		     context: (id)context

{
	self = [super init];

	@try {
		void *pool = objc_autoreleasePoolPush();
		OFMutableData *queryData;
		uint16_t tmp;

		_host = [host copy];
		_recordClass = recordClass;
		_recordType = recordType;
		_ID = [ID retain];
		_nameServers = [nameServers copy];
		_searchDomains = [searchDomains copy];

		_target = [target retain];
		_selector = selector;
		_context = [context retain];

		queryData = [OFMutableData dataWithCapacity: 512];

		/* Header */

		tmp = OF_BSWAP16_IF_LE([ID uInt16Value]);
		[queryData addItems: &tmp
			      count: 2];

		/* RD */
		tmp = OF_BSWAP16_IF_LE(1 << 8);
		[queryData addItems: &tmp
			      count: 2];

		/* QDCOUNT */
		tmp = OF_BSWAP16_IF_LE(1);
		[queryData addItems: &tmp
			      count: 2];

		/* ANCOUNT, NSCOUNT and ARCOUNT */
		[queryData increaseCountBy: 6];

		/* Question */

		/* QNAME */
		for (OFString *component in
		    [host componentsSeparatedByString: @"."]) {
			size_t length = [component UTF8StringLength];
			uint8_t length8;

			if (length > 63 || [queryData count] + length > 512)
				@throw [OFOutOfRangeException exception];

			length8 = (uint8_t)length;
			[queryData addItem: &length8];
			[queryData addItems: [component UTF8String]
				      count: length];
		}

		/* QTYPE */
		tmp = OF_BSWAP16_IF_LE(recordType);
		[queryData addItems: &tmp
			      count: 2];

		/* QCLASS */
		tmp = OF_BSWAP16_IF_LE(recordClass);
		[queryData addItems: &tmp
			 count: 2];

		[queryData makeImmutable];

		_queryData = [queryData copy];

		objc_autoreleasePoolPop(pool);
	} @catch (id e) {
		[self release];
		@throw e;
	}

	return self;
}

- (void)dealloc
{
	[_host release];
	[_ID release];
	[_nameServers release];
	[_searchDomains release];

	[_target release];
	[_context release];
	[_queryData release];
	[_cancelTimer release];

	[super dealloc];
}
@end
